clarify that > in the verbose output can contain newlines

To control where this URL is written, use the \fI-o/--output\fP or the \fI-O/--remote-name\fP options. .IP "-v/--verbose" Makes the fetching more verbose/talkative. Mostly usable for debugging. Lines -starting with '>' means data sent by curl, '<' means data received by curl -that is hidden in normal cases and lines starting with '*' means additional -info provided by curl. +starting with '>' means data sent by curl (this data may in itself contain +newlines), '<' means data received by curl that is hidden in normal cases and +lines starting with '*' means additional info provided by curl. Note that if you only want HTTP headers in the output, \fI-i/--include\fP might be option you're looking for. |
